Onshore Outsourcing

From Canonica AI

Introduction

Onshore outsourcing, also known as domestic outsourcing, is a business strategy where a company contracts out certain tasks or services to a third-party provider within the same country. This practice is often used to reduce operating costs, increase efficiency, and allow the company to focus on its core competencies.

A business meeting in a modern office, where a company is discussing their onshore outsourcing strategy.
A business meeting in a modern office, where a company is discussing their onshore outsourcing strategy.

Overview

Onshore outsourcing can involve a wide range of services, from IT and software development to customer service and human resources. It is a popular choice for businesses that want to maintain a high level of control over their outsourced tasks, as the geographical proximity and shared time zone can facilitate easier communication and collaboration.

Advantages of Onshore Outsourcing

There are several advantages to onshore outsourcing. These include:

Cost Savings

While onshore outsourcing can be more expensive than offshore outsourcing, it can still result in significant cost savings. This is because the company does not have to invest in the infrastructure, equipment, or personnel necessary to perform the outsourced tasks.

Improved Communication

With onshore outsourcing, there are no language barriers or significant time zone differences to contend with. This can lead to improved communication, faster response times, and a smoother overall workflow.

Quality Control

Onshore outsourcing can also offer better quality control. The company can more easily monitor the work being done, and the third-party provider is more likely to be familiar with local standards and regulations.

Risk Mitigation

Outsourcing tasks to a provider in the same country can help mitigate risks associated with legal issues, data security, and cultural misunderstandings.

Disadvantages of Onshore Outsourcing

Despite its advantages, onshore outsourcing also has potential drawbacks:

Higher Costs

Compared to offshore outsourcing, onshore outsourcing can be more expensive. This is due to higher labor costs in developed countries.

Limited Pool of Talent

Depending on the industry and the specific tasks being outsourced, there may be a limited pool of qualified providers within the country.

Dependence on Third-Party Providers

Onshore outsourcing can lead to dependence on the third-party provider. If the provider encounters problems, it can disrupt the company's operations.

Onshore vs Offshore Outsourcing

While both onshore and offshore outsourcing can offer cost savings and efficiency gains, there are key differences between the two. Onshore outsourcing offers the advantages of geographical proximity, easier communication, and greater control over the outsourced tasks. However, it can also be more expensive and may offer a smaller pool of potential providers.

Offshore outsourcing, on the other hand, can offer significant cost savings due to lower labor costs in developing countries. However, it can also present challenges related to communication, quality control, and data security.

Conclusion

Onshore outsourcing is a valuable tool for businesses looking to reduce costs, increase efficiency, and focus on their core competencies. While it can be more expensive than offshore outsourcing, the benefits of improved communication, better quality control, and risk mitigation can make it a worthwhile investment.

See Also